Jim Schwartz discusses departure from Browns after head coaching search

Jim Schwartz has resigned from his role as defensive coordinator for the Cleveland Browns after the team hired Todd Monken as head coach. Schwartz, who was a candidate for the head coaching position, stated that he could not continue in his role after being passed over for the promotion. He has chosen to step away from coaching for the upcoming season.

Slow Sales for NJ Transit World Cup Train Tickets Ahead of Tournament

Ticket sales for NJ Transit train services to MetLife Stadium for the upcoming World Cup games have been low, with only 17,739 tickets sold out of 320,000 available. New Jersey Governor Mikie Sherrill criticized FIFA for not covering transportation costs, while FIFA responded by stating that it does not typically pay for fan transportation at major events.

Spain bans DR Congo World Cup warm-up match due to Ebola concerns

The mayor of La Linea de la Concepcion has banned a warm-up match for the Democratic Republic of Congo ahead of the 2026 World Cup, citing fears related to the Ebola virus. The match was scheduled to take place in the Spanish city.
